4) What is an instance?
Ans. When you call a function module, an instance
of its function group plus its data, is loaded into the memory area of the
internal session. An ABAP program can load several instances by calling
function modules from different function groups.

Ans. Central
information repository for application and system data. The ABAP Dictionary
contains data definitions (metadata) that allow you to describe all of the data
structures in the system (like tables, views, and data types) in one place.
This eliminates redundancy.
9) Difference between domain and
data element? What are aggregate object?
Ans. Domain - Specifies the technical attributes of
a data element - its data type, length, possible values, and appearance on the
screen. Each data element has an underlying domain. A single domain can be the
basis for several data elements. Domains are objects in the ABAP Dictionary.
Data Element - Describes the
business function of a table field. Its technical attributes are based on a
domain, and its business function is described by its field labels and
documentation.
Aggregate Object Views, Match
Code and Lock objects are called aggregate objects because they are formed from
several related table.

Ans. A step loop is a repeated series of field-blocks
in a screen. Each block can contain one or more fields, and can extend over
more than one line on the screen.
Step
loops as structures in a screen do not have individual names. The screen can
contain more than one step-loop, but if so, you must program the
LOOP...ENDLOOPs in the flow logic accordingly. The ordering of the
TrAns action
TZ61 (development class SDWA) implements a step loop version of the table you
saw in Trans action TZ60.
Static
and Dynamic Step Loops
Step
loops fall into two classes: static and dynamic. Static step loops have a fixed
size that cannot be changed at runtime. Dynamic step loops are variable in
size. If the user re-sizes the window, the system automatically increases or
decreases the number of step loop blocks displayed. In any given screen, you
can define any number of static step loops, but only a single dynamic one.
You
specify the class for a step loop in the Screen Painter. Each loop in a screen
has the attributes Looptype (fixed=static, variable=dynamic) and Loopcount. If
a loop is fixed, the Loopcount tells the number of loop-blocks displayed for
the loop. This number can never change.
